CLIENT-SIDE API SERVER-SIDE API DescriptionThe Telerik UI for ASP.NET MVC Data Grid provides the column-virtualization feature, which enables you to operate with a large number of columns where displaying them at once will not impose a performance penalty due to limited browser resources.
This demo shows how to implement the column-virtualization functionality of the ASP.NET MVC Data Grid to mitigate any slowdowns when operating with huge numbers of columns. To enable column virtualization, use the .Scrollable(scrollable => scrollable.Virtual(GridVirtualizationMode.Columns))
configuration option. As a result, the component will display only part of all its columns, and when the user scrolls the Grid, the visual subset of columns will change accordingly.
You can also use column virtualization together with row virtualization and, in this way, increase the performance substantially of the Data Grid.
